This podcast offers insightful discussions centered around the feed industry, featuring experts who share their knowledge on various topics such as feed production, animal nutrition, and food safety. Episodes delve into issues like pathogen control, grain prices, and innovative nutritional strategies, all aimed at enhancing efficiency in feed manufacturing and ensuring animal health. With a format that blends expert insights with practical applications, the content is tailored for professionals seeking to stay current with the latest trends and research findings in their field.
